:root{--color-primary: #bbd6bb;--color-secondary: #F0F7F0;--color-tertiary: #F0F7F0;--color-tertiary-transparent: transparent;--button-background-color: #a7a36f;--button-hover-color: #0056b3;--button-text-color: #ffffff;--text-color-dark: #000000;--text-color-light: #000000;--text-color-hover: #000000;--border-color: transparent;--scrollbar-background: #F0F7F0;--color-scrollbar: gray;--color-accent: #051935;--wether-icon-background-color: black;--clr-1: #052b2f;--clr-2: #073438;--clr-3: #0e4b50;--clr-4: #2d8f85;--clr-5: #637c54;--info-terminal-font-size: .8rem}.loginContainer{display:flex;flex-direction:column;height:100%;top:0;background-color:var(--color-secondary);border-radius:8px;box-shadow:0 4px 8px #0000001a;width:98%;margin:40px auto;padding:2rem}.loginContainer form{display:flex;flex-direction:column;gap:1rem}.loginContainer form .form-header{display:flex;justify-content:space-around;margin-bottom:1rem;border:solid 1px #ccc;border-radius:5px}.loginContainer form .form-header button{width:100%;background-color:transparent;border:none;padding:.5rem 1rem;margin-bottom:-1px;border-radius:0 5px 5px 0;cursor:pointer;font-weight:700}.loginContainer form .form-header button:disabled{background-color:var(--button-background-color);color:var(--text-color-light)}.loginContainer form .form-header button:not(:disabled){color:#000}.loginContainer form .form-header .signup-btn{border-radius:0 5px 5px 0}.loginContainer form .form-header .login-btn{border-radius:5px 0 0 5px}.loginContainer form label{color:#333}.loginContainer form input[type=text],.loginContainer form input[type=password],.loginContainer form input[type=email]{border:1px solid #ccc;border-radius:4px;padding:.5rem;font-size:1rem}.loginContainer form input[type=text]:focus,.loginContainer form input[type=password]:focus,.loginContainer form input[type=email]:focus{border-color:#ebe1cc;outline:none}.loginContainer form .forgot-password{color:var(--text-color-light);text-align:right;margin-top:-1rem}.loginContainer form .submit-btn{background-color:var(--button-background-color);color:var(--text-color-light);border:none;border-radius:4px;padding:.75rem;font-size:1.1rem;cursor:pointer}.loginContainer form .submit-btn:hover{background-color:var(--button-hover-background-color);transform:scale(1.05)}.loginContainer form .signup-link{text-align:center}.loginContainer form .signup-link span{color:var(--text-color-light);cursor:pointer;text-decoration:underline}.loginContainer form .signup-link span:hover{text-decoration:none}.loginContainer .gardener-checkbox{display:flex;align-items:center;margin-bottom:1rem}.loginContainer .gardener-checkbox input[type=checkbox]{margin-right:.5rem;width:30px;height:30px}.loginContainer .gardener-checkbox label{cursor:pointer}.loginContainer input[name=meterNumber]{border:1px dashed #ccc}.loginContainer .error-message,.loginContainer .instruction{color:#c00;font-size:.9rem;text-align:center;margin-top:-.5rem;margin-bottom:1rem}
